Blinken discussed with Kuleba the cooperation between the United States and Ukraine in the field of security and economy

US Secretary of State Anthony Blinken had a phone conversation with Ukrainian Foreign Minister Dmytro Kuleba, during which they discussed security and economic cooperation issues, the State Department said.

“They discussed continuing strong security and economic cooperation as the large-scale, unprovoked invasion of Ukraine approaches one year,” the department spokesperson said. of State, Ned Price.

“The Secretary underscored the United States’ unwavering commitment to Ukraine, including the recent provision of additional security assistance to help Ukraine continue to defend itself against Russian aggression,” he said. said Price.

The State Department did not provide details of the conversation.
